- Operation contains too many activities ?The SAP error message
/SAPAPO/CDPSOPT828
indicates that an operation in the SAP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O) system contains too many activities. This error typically arises when the number of activities associated with a particular operation exceeds the system's predefined limits.Cause:
- Excessive Activities: The operation in question has more activities than the system can handle. This can occur in scenarios where a production order or a planned order has a large number of operations or activities defined.
- Configuration Limits: The system has certain configuration limits for the number of activities that can be processed for a single operation. When these limits are exceeded, the error is triggered.
- Data Integrity Issues: There may be issues with the data integrity in the master data or transaction data that lead to an unexpected number of activities being generated.
Solution:
- Review and Optimize Activities: Check the operation in question and review the activities associated with it. If there are unnecessary activities, consider removing or consolidating them.
- Adjust Configuration Settings: If the business process requires a higher number of activities, you may need to adjust the configuration settings in the APO system. This may involve increasing the limits for activities per operation, but this should be done with caution and in consultation with your SAP Basis or APO consultant.
- Data Cleanup: Ensure that there are no data integrity issues. Check for any duplicate or erroneous entries in the master data that could be causing the excessive number of activities.
- Batch Processing: If applicable, consider breaking down the operation into smaller batches that can be processed separately, thus reducing the number of activities per operation.
- Consult SAP Notes: Check the SAP Support Portal for any relevant SAP Notes that may address this specific error or provide guidance on configuration changes.
